Pique in Arbeloa ‘conocido’ jibe

Barcelona defender Gerard Pique hit back at Alvaro Arbeloa with a sarcastic play-on-words as he called the Real Madrid full-back a “cono … cido”.

Arbeloa recently claimed that Pique was his friend, who would be involved in the comedy circuit once he retired from football, and the Catalan stopper replied to his rival by branding him both a ‘conocido’, translating to ‘acquaintance’, and the derogatory term ‘cono’.

“It’s a blow, but we’ll bounce back. They were brave and deserved the point,” he said after Barca’s 2-2 draw with Deportivo on Saturday.

“We had control of the game for 75 minutes in a dignified manner but it ran away from us.

“It’s the second time this has happened [against Depor], but I’m sure we’ll rise again.

“We haven’t thought about the Club World Cup. The last few minutes cost us a lot and it’s never good to drop points at Camp Nou.

“Arbeloa proclaims to be my friend, but he’s only a ‘conocido’ [an acquaintance], a ‘cono’ … cido.”
